Construct a square ABCD, when: One diagonal = 5.4 cm.

We know that the diagonals of a square are equal and bisect each other at right angles.

Steps:

1. draw AC = 5.4cm.

2. Draw the right bisector XY of AC, meeting AC at O.

3. From O, set off OB = `1/2` (5.4) = 2.7cm along OY and along OX.

4. Join AB, BC, CD, and DA.

ABCD is the required square.
